Ruffle Scarf

I am fairly certain, without looking, that there are several, if not tons, of similar patterns on Ravelry for scarves like this.  But....  I didn't use them.  I picked out some yarn and needles and got started without a real plan or pattern.  Basically, it was going to be a really long skinny rectangle, but I quickly got bored with that plan.  I knit this scarf longways, so I decided to add a ruffle to one of the long sides.
I cast on about 300 stitches on a 36" 6 mm circular needle with my yarn, Bernat Mosaic in Ninja, held double.  I knit about 1.5 inches in garter stitch and then decided to make a ruffle.  On the next row, I knit two together, knit one, knit two together, knit one......  This cut the length of the scarf by a third.  Then, I kept up the garter stitch until I was about to run out of yarn.  This gave me about a 4.5 inch wide scarf that is about 48 inches long.
